Given that PYTHONPATH contains .../pythonX.Y/site-packages
And a package that contains some private 3rd party stubs under .../pythonX.Y/site-packages/foo/some_stubs
When setting MYPYPATH to .../pythonX.Y/site-packages/foo/some_stubs
Then mypy gives the error .../pythonX.Y/site-packages is in the MYPYPATH. Please remove it..
This is wrong because:
MYPYPATH does not include ../pythonX.Y/site-packages. It does include .../pythonX.Y/site-packages/foo/some_stubs but that is a very different directory.
Due to this error mypy refuses to use the stubs listed in MYPYPATH in this case.
This probably isn't intentional? The relevant PEP explicitly allows for MYPYPATH and does not seem to mention any restriction on the location of stubs added via MYPYPATH.
It is possible to work around the problem by copying (or linking) the stubs to a directory which is not under ../pythonX.Y/site-packages, say into ~/.foo-stubs and adding this path to MYPYPATH.

What would be the motivation of forbidding this?
The semantics of MYPYPATH are entirely up to the type checker using it. In addition, we do not want to add anything in site packages to the MYPYPATH, as that can be problematic. In general it is better to add a py.typed file and not use MYPYPATH for installed packages.
The reason for this check is that almost any time someone tries to include site-packages in $MYPYPATH it causes problems -- it just is almost never what you want. Hence the explicit check (easy to find in the mypy source by grepping for "Please remove it"). I don't think the use case of stubs distributed in a subdirectory of an installed package is important enough to make an exception, and your workaround sounds better -- though using a separate stubs package as described in PEP 561 would probably be better.
